Output ecd4bca38b0529f6688f8095503f8198abe91cbe498cb795dc0c6dae489c7298:9

value
2019878
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e07645a8b0c6eccde25934f6e3ed5b247b3857e2 OP_EQUAL
address
3N9ryCmXPkjLhGbCA8jGMnkZYcaUhCaTSD
transaction
ecd4bca38b0529f6688f8095503f8198abe91cbe498cb795dc0c6dae489c7298
confirmations
296757
spent
true